                            Sixty-ninth Legislative Assembly of North Dakota 
In Regular Session Commencing Tuesday, January 7, 2025
SENATE BILL NO. 2207
(Senators Patten, Marcellais, Walen, Weston)
(Representatives Brown, Davis)
AN ACT to amend and reenact subsection 2 of section 57-40.3-04 of the North Dakota Century Code, 
relating to a motor vehicle excise tax exemption for tribal governments; and to provide an 
effective date.
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ATIVE ASSEMBLY OF NORTH DAKOTA:
SECTION 1. AMENDMENT. Subsection 2 of section 57-40.3-04 of the North Dakota Century Code 
is amended and reenacted as follows:
2.a.Any motor vehicle procured by, owned by, or in possession of the: 
(1)The federal orgovernment;
(2)The state government or a;
(3)A political subdivision thereofof this state;
(4)A tribal government of a federally recognized Indian tribe within the boundaries of 
any reservation in this state; or a motor vehicle procured by or
(5)A person on behalf of the North Dakota lottery thatwhen the motor vehicle is to be 
awarded as a prize in a game or promotion.
b.For purposes of this subsection, an "Indian tribe" means a tribal government agency, 
instrumentality, or political subdivision that performs essential government functions. The 
term does not include a business entity or agency with the primary purpose of operating 
a business enterprise.
SECTION 2. EFFECTIVE DATE. This Act is effective for taxable events occurring after June 30, 
2025. S. B. NO. 2207 - PAGE 2
